Seeing as it is embossed in gold, your great grandfather was also, most likey a Past Commander of his Commandery.
 

PatrickWilliams

I could tell you ...
Seeing as it is embossed in gold, your great grandfather was also, most likey a Past Commander of his Commandery.
Well ... ALL the blades are done in gold, the real clue here is that the scabbard and hilt fittings are gold, too. Most definitely a KT commander's sword.
